Output 38494da3c44e095366f6cf2142cecd7a77b3ea069bac15b35f0e8119c5baff65:5

value
19422
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 abfa7c3b584366051b319dfef525c964e2fca0021253b15ada97ec313120c020
address
bc1p40a8cw6cgdnq2xe3nhl02fwfvn30egqzzffmzkk6jlkrzvfqcqsqfeafkc
transaction
38494da3c44e095366f6cf2142cecd7a77b3ea069bac15b35f0e8119c5baff65
confirmations
86959
spent
true